Ichiro's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Splitting Ichiro's full recorded timeline at 1929, 34%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 66% in the earlier half -- the name was more prevalent in its earlier era than it is today. Its quietest year on record was 1927,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1920 peak of 21 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Ichiro by state

Where Ichiro concentrates geographically, total births since 1915

Regionally concentrated
Top 2 states by recorded births for the name Ichiro
Rank State Visual share Births Share of total
#1 Hawaii
77 26.9%
#2 California
69 24.1%
